26JK0008-Widening of Permanent Bridges - Talisayan Br. (B001160MN) along Zamboanga City- Labuan-Limpapa Rd

The Department of Public Works and Highways, Zamboanga City 1st District Engineering Office is inviting bids for a single‑lot civil works project under the title “Widening of Permanent Bridges – Talisayan Bridge (B001160MN) along Zamboanga City–Labuan–Limpapa Road.” The procurement concerns the expansion of the existing bridge structure to improve vehicular and pedestrian capacity on the arterial route connecting Zamboanga City to the surrounding areas. The scope encompasses the design, construction and any related permanent works necessary to widen the bridge while maintaining continuous traffic flow and structural integrity during the project life cycle.

Bidding will be conducted under the Competitive Bidding (Public Bidding) method pursuant to the Implementing Rules and Regulations and the latest Philippine Government Procurement Act. The contract is priced under a regular agency fund, with a single lot awarding to qualified bidders who meet the eligibility criteria of the Department and possess relevant experience in similar bridge widening or rehabilitation projects within the last five years. The successful contractor will be required to complete the works within the stipulated period, coordinate traffic management plans, and adhere to all safety, quality and environmental safeguards customary for national bridge projects.

All works shall comply with the Philippine Standard for Highway Bridge Design and Construction.

Asuncion-San Isidro-Laak-Veruela Rd K1518 + 422 - K1518 + 513

The Department of Public Works and Highways Davao de Oro 1st District Engineering Office is soliciting bids for heavy construction services on the Asuncion–San Isidro–Laak–Veruela road segment K1518 + 421 to K1518 + 513. The project covers a 91‑meter length of roadway located in Laak, Davao de Oro, and includes comprehensive earthwork and structural works that will protect and stabilize the road corridor while enhancing its operational integrity. The contract is structured as a single lot, encompassing all work required for the comprehensive rehabilitation of the specified corridor.

The scope of work includes construction of grouted riprap slope protection, roadway and surplus common excavation, reconstruction of damaged pavement, construction of canal lining and other minor drainage structures, erection of a mechanised soil‑cement (MSE) wall, and application of reflectorised thermoplastic pavement markings. The selected contractor must perform all geotechnical and civil procedures in accordance with the design specifications for grouted riprap slope protection, MSE wall, excavation, drainage, pavement reconstruction, and reflective thermoplastic pavement markings for the designated 91 m section.

Construction of Multi-Purpose Building (Barangay Hall), Barangay Concepcion, Mawab, Davao de Oro (125.936100, 7.466400)

The Department of Public Works and Highways, Davao de Oro 1st District Engineering Office is soliciting bids to construct a one‑storey multi‑purpose building to serve as the Barangay Hall of Barangay Concepcion in Mawab, Davao de Oro, located at 125.936100° E, 7.466400° N. The project requires the design and erection of a fully functional hall equipped with tables, chairs, cabinets, a 30 kVA standby power house, solar panels, a fire detection and alarm system, and a 200‑liter stainless‑steel water tank. The construction must be completed within 214 calendar days and comply with the applicable civil works standards set by the Philippine Contractors Accreditation Board.

The contract falls under the “Construction of Multi‑Purpose Building” category, classified as a small B project under the Heavy Construction Services business type, with a total approved budget for the contract of nine million nine hundred thousand Philippine pesos. Eligible bidders must hold a PCAB license in the C & D classification, demonstrate past performance on comparable projects, and meet all DPWH financial capacity requirements as outlined in the bidding documents. Submissions will be evaluated using the Lowest Calculated Responsive Bid methodology, and bids exceeding the approved budget will be rejected at opening.

All technical specifications, quality standards, and safety requirements to be met are detailed in the procurement documents and must be strictly adhered to throughout the project lifecycle.

26HA0080 – Construction of Road, Barangay Cabawan – Barangay Carbon Road, Cabawan District (Sta. 000 + 000.00 – Sta. 001 + 000.00), Tagbilaran City, Bohol

The Department of Public Works and Highways – Bohol 1st District Engineering Office invites qualified Philippine firms to submit competitive bids for the construction of a concrete road linking Barangay Cabawan to Barangay Carbon Road in the Cabawan District of Tagbilaran City. The project specifies the execution of a concrete roadway extending from the beginning of the alignment (Sta. 000 + 000.00) to the end point (Sta. 001 + 000.00), covering a total linear distance that must be completed within 111 calendar days. The bid package contains full descriptions and technical specifications for the road design, reconstruction, or new construction per DPWH Civil Works standards, and it requires that bidders demonstrate successful performance on an equivalent contract within the preceding five years.

Eligible bidders must be Philippine citizens or entities with at least 60% Philippine ownership, possess the required PCAB license in categories C or D, and be registered in the DPWH Civil Works Application system. Bids are subject to a strict pass/fail evaluation under the New Government Procurement Act, with the lowest calculated responsive bid being the award criterion. The bidding process involves a pre‑bid conference, submission of a bid security, and acceptance of bids no later than 12:00 N.N. on 15 July 2026. All proposals must be received (manual or electronic) pursuant to the procurement guidelines, and only bids within the approved budget for the Contract will be considered.

All work shall conform to the Department's Civil Works specifications and the Philippine standards for concrete road construction.

26HA0086 – Construction of MPB (Bohol International Convention Center), Panglao, Bohol

The Department of Public Works and Highways – Bohol 1st District Engineering Office is issuing a public bid for the construction of the Main Project Building (MPB) of the Bohol International Convention Center on Panglao Island in Bohol. The contract, identified as 26HA0086, calls for the complete erection of the convention facility within a 180‑day calendar period, and bidding is limited to Filipino citizens, sole proprietorships, cooperatives, or partnerships that possess at least sixty percent Filipino ownership. Prospective contractors must demonstrate experience on a comparable project within the last five years and be registered with the Philippine Contractors Accreditation Board for a small‑business size classification.

Eligible bidders will be required to submit a complete set of bidding documents, a bid security, and a duly authorized representative, and will be evaluated on the lowest calculated responsive bid. The procurement follows the New Government Procurement Act guidelines, with pre‑bid conferences, electronic and manual submission windows, and a public bid opening scheduled for July 20, 2026. All construction shall comply with Philippine Standards and local building regulations.
